Engine Swap help.

Would a 429 thunderjet engine 4 barrel carb. out of a 69 thunderbird fit into my 1988 camaro coupe which has a v8 305 in it. Please let me know, thanks.

Your Ford 429 is a great engine and deserves to be placed in a decent car, but the Camaro is not the best choice.

Your 429 is the same externally as the Ford 460 big block. It could be made to fit the Camaro, but it would be a very expensive proposition.

1. The 429 has a front-sump oil pan, so the engine would not fit the Camaro frame, unless it was changed to a 'rear sump', which would take some time and effort.

2. The Ford engine would not bolt up to the Camaro transmission. You would have so source a Ford transmission strong enough to handle the 429's power, such as a C-6 automatic or a Top-Loader 4 speed manual.

3. Lots of custom installation work would be required, to fabricate engine mounts, transmission mounts, a driveshaft, low-pressure fuel pump, throttle linkage, cooling system hook-ups etc.

4. the Camaro, I think, has a torque arm that connects the rear axle to the transmission..... I do not know if such a thing can be fabricated to mate with a Ford tramsission, so some rear suspension mods would be required.

It would be much better to sell your 429 and use the money towards building a Chevy 350 or 383 to go in the Camaro.

Agreed with MR. You could also look into a "Fox Body" Mustang of the era. Relatively cheap and plentiful, that chassis is actually better "equipped" to handle the power of a big block, AND... Many companies make the "swap" pieces necessary to install the Lima (BBF) in the little car, including very nice headers.

We DO often use GM transmissions behind Ford engines, mainly TH400 and PowerGlide. Adapters are readily available.

IMO, the MOST effective engine one can put in a 3rd gen Camaro without cutting it all up or "breaking the bank" would be a 383 Chevy ("stroked" 350). But that also comes under the "everybody has one" stigma...
